Key takeaways
- Motion control: Memory foam generally absorbs movement more effectively than traditional interconnected coils. If one partner changes position frequently, look for dense comfort layers or individually wrapped springs rather than a highly responsive, bouncy design.
- Support and alignment: A mattress should keep the hips from dropping substantially below the shoulders. Medium-firm construction is often a practical starting point for couples because it accommodates different sleeping positions without feeling excessively rigid.
- Temperature management: Cooling gel, copper or graphite additives, breathable covers, open-cell foam, and coil ventilation may reduce heat retention. No material eliminates heat entirely, so room temperature, bedding, and sleepwear still matter.
- Edge stability: Strong perimeter support gives each sleeper more usable surface area and makes getting in or out easier. This is especially important in a king bed, where couples may naturally sleep near opposite edges.
- Durability indicators: Check foam certifications, layer thickness, warranty terms, and the manufacturer’s break-in guidance. CertiPUR-US certification addresses certain emissions and material standards, but it is not a guarantee of long-term firmness retention.

Choosing a king mattress for two people is less about finding the softest surface and more about controlling the problems that become obvious when a bed is shared: partner movement, uneven support, heat buildup, and edge collapse. A mattress that feels comfortable for one sleeper can still leave another waking when a partner turns or sinking into a poor spinal position.
This guide evaluates king mattresses through an ergonomics-and-durability lens. The focus is on pressure distribution, motion isolation, ventilation, structural support, material certifications, and the practical realities of buying a mattress compressed in a box. The selections below suit different couple profiles, from back sleepers seeking firmer support to partners who prioritize cooling and reduced movement transfer.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is a king mattress best for couples?
A king provides considerably more personal space than a queen, which can reduce accidental contact and disturbance during sleep. It is most beneficial when the bedroom can accommodate the larger footprint while leaving safe walking clearance around the bed.
What mattress firmness is best for two people?
Medium-firm is usually the most versatile starting point because it supports back and stomach sleepers while offering enough cushioning for many side sleepers. If partners have significantly different needs, a split king with independently selected sides may be more effective than compromising on one shared feel.
Are memory foam mattresses good for couples?
Yes, particularly when minimizing motion transfer is a priority. Foam can absorb turning and getting in or out of bed, but some dense models retain heat or make repositioning feel effortful, so ventilation and responsiveness should be considered alongside pressure relief.
How long should a boxed mattress expand?
Most compressed mattresses need several hours to regain their intended shape, and some benefit from a full day or two before evaluation.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ions, avoid judging firmness immediately, and allow adequate ventilation during the initial unboxing period.
